## Data Stores: Report Exports

Quick heads-up for reviewers: the Quillbarn export service stores all timestamps in UTC and converts to the requester's timezone at render time, never at write time. If an export looks shifted by a few hours, it's almost always a client sending a bad offset, not the store. DST transitions are handled by the `tz_shift` view in the reporting replica. To inspect that view yourself, connect to the replica with the connection string below.

primary connection of kahof-kagep = mssql://belath_svc:3uqY4g6LHG5Nyi@db-d0ba.ferralabs.corp:5432/rusdor

### Step 7: Migrate the Proctoring Queue Tables

The ExamWarden queue previously stored session claims and heartbeat rows in the monolith database. This step moves both tables to the dedicated queue store. Run the schema script first, then the backfill; verify row counts match before cutting over. Future maintainers should note that the backfill tool reaches the new store using the connection string below.

replica DSN, yahaf-yagaf: mongodb://tamath_svc:a2netSk3RZMuTj@db-d084.novacsoft.internal:5432/ralmir

Finance Review Summary — Hedging Decision

Reviewed Q3 exposure on the Velran crown following the Osterfeld expansion. Forward contracts locked for 70% of projected receivables; remainder floats per Tavrin's model. Cost of carry acceptable; downside capped at tolerance threshold. No objections from treasury. Decision stands through year-end unless volatility doubles. The strategic rationale behind the partial hedge is noted below.

confidential, bahop-hahif: Only 3 of the 140 pilot accounts renewed Oliath, so a churn review is set for July 15.

Changed defaults in Splitfork, our assignment service. Bucketing now uses sticky hashing per account instead of per session, and the holdout slice grew from 2% to 5%. Callers relying on session-level reassignment must opt in explicitly. Review the diff against the new baseline; the updated default configuration is listed below.

config for tagep-kajof:
[casir]
port = 6379
region = south-1
host = casir.paliqdyn.example
team = tamax
timeout_ms = 250
retries = 2